Output 99ee66e36288d97930fe33e548b85e9e30623812506efd4f37b5108352d85a24:0

value
62598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d30a266c3dddc46dc9af34ec47a94b44688dc50 OP_EQUAL
address
3LPxi3ZcJTEASmcChAxt9jZ9Y9DQDi9QMU
transaction
99ee66e36288d97930fe33e548b85e9e30623812506efd4f37b5108352d85a24
confirmations
213966
spent
true